Output 17e8635622cf09cad2c5fc09950793ec59c61dbef3276d26eb05b6b40c944289:3

value
349390115
script pubkey
OP_0 OP_PUSHBYTES_20 76c229a473d64b5c34e3e6877237d8232560e8ee
address
bc1qwmpznfrn6e94cd8ru6rhyd7cyvjkp68wke5dpz
transaction
17e8635622cf09cad2c5fc09950793ec59c61dbef3276d26eb05b6b40c944289
spent
true